How to fill out the Workplace Chemical List online
The Workplace Chemical List is an essential document for agricultural employers to report chemicals used in their operations. This guide will assist you in completing this form online efficiently and accurately.
Follow the steps to complete the Workplace Chemical List.
- Press the 'Get Form' button to access the form and open it in your preferred editor.
- Enter the federal ID number in the designated field if you are submitting the form to the Texas Department of Agriculture (TDA). This number is mandatory for verification.
- Fill out your mailing address, including city and ZIP code. Ensure this information is correct for efficient correspondence.
- Input the name of the agricultural employer, which can be either a firm or an individual. This section identifies who is responsible for chemical usage.
- Select the county where your workplace is located. This is important for regulatory tracking.
- Designate the storage area location of the chemicals, providing specific details if it is different from the work area.
- Record the date when the product was applied or stored to maintain an accurate timeline of chemical usage.
- Indicate the location of the work area that was treated or the storage area if different from the previous entry.
- List the name of the crop associated with the chemical usage. This helps in monitoring agricultural safety.
- Provide the name of the product applied or stored. Make sure to use the common name recognized by regulatory bodies.
- Fill in the EPA registration number of the product to validate its safety and compliance with federal regulations.
- Estimate the amount of product applied per acre or stored, selecting the appropriate unit of measurement from pounds, ounces, quarts, or gallons.
- Specify the total acres treated with the chemical, which is critical for agricultural record-keeping.
- Indicate whether you have a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S) available for each pesticide used. This is a legal requirement. If present, note 'Y', otherwise enter 'N'.
